So, Big fan of LBA. Played the original and was super excited about this remake... And I couldn't be more disappointed with the outcome. I played the Demo and had my concerns, but I believed they could deliver something good (even with all the feedback provided by the community) and it feels like a flop. I finished the main story and will probably try to get all the achievements. I'll try to outline the pros/cons of the game from my point of view.

PROS:

- The visuals/graphics is a nice improvement from the original. I'm not the biggest fan of the aesthetics but it kind of fits here. It feels fresh and nice.
- The music is a plus for me.
- Overall I love the character design and how the levels were tailored (e.g. FunFrock's design is awesome!)

CONS:

- Same as in the Demo, I don't understand why you put Luna there. The story makes 0 sense with her in it. And it feels like she's annoying/super childish.
- Regarding the story: in the original game Twinsen was imprisoned due to his dreams/visions regarding Sendell... Here he lets FunFrock do his thing, take power, zoe leaves him and he doesn't seem to care at all. He gets arrested only when Luna breaks "the law" by playing the basketball. Again, nonsense. It tries to make the situation less darker than it should be.
- The "magic" ball has the worst physics I've ever seen. It does whatever the heck it wants, if you right-click mid air it resets the throw.. that mechanic feels awful.
- The combat... face an enemy wrongly/let them shot you a bit and you get stunlocked and die.
- Hitboxes are terrible, you may be hitting with the sword or the ball and it doesn't register it correctly.
- The AI pathing... is awful. I had Zoe get stuck in Citadel Island's bridge in the prologue, and the enemy AI is just non-existant. You can literally run through the levels and no one bats an eye.
- Why,. for the love of Sendell, you had to remove the sneak from the game?
- Also, when Twinsen stops running/walking it just T-poses for a brief moment.. there's no stop animation and it feels awful.
- Twinsen-Zoe chemistry is non-existant. How will it be linked on the 2nd game?
- Why can't we drive the tank...
- I found myself jumping in random places and got to "break" the game by getting softlocked in some corners...
- When you exit a building, ALL doors are open and they close at the same time.
- If you talk to a character while rolling/jumping (and even normally) it messes up the audio.
- For whatever reason the dialogues didn't match the text properly.
- There's a sign in Principal Island that has no text in it (It's just blank).
- The list goes on...

I really, really, really hope they can address SOME of the issues and make the game a bit better. If that happens I'll change my review, but as of now I cannot recommend the game for its full price.

I'm gonna recommend the game because it's a nice remake of LBA. I found some good things and some bad ones but overall the game is awesome.

- The Graphics: the screenshots talk by themselves, but the improvement on the graphics is massive. There're some things to tweak here and there but the care and love for the game are present. It's really nice to see and it feels smooth when going through the map.
- Music: It's SUBLIME. Having played the original ones, I didn't expect the music to be this good.
- Dialogues: On point. Twinsen's voice is 10/10. Maybe I'm too picky but FunkFrock's voice doesn't seem TOO evil to me.
- Movement/Combat: It has some things to fix but it's really good. I love they changed the 4 states (normal, sporty, aggressive and discreet) and remade it the way they did. But for me, not being able to sneak through (tiptoe, be discreet) felt like a bad decision. The discreet mode was used A LOT in the originals, e.g: the interaction with Sendell's ball when being thrown. Also, found some glitches when kicking/punching, it was not registering correctly even with the enemies in front of me (again, it's a demo and they need to fix/polish things.
- On to the story: I understand that you wanted to change Zoe for something else. But a sister? I'm not so sure how that would be linked on LBA2 (the whole aliens, twinsen living with zoe, expecting a baby, etc). In the original game, Twinsen was put in the asylum due to his dreams/prophecies about Sendell... and now it's changed to saving his sister from the bad guys. I have to say, I'm not convinced on this angle, but will play it with an open mind when it releases.

The one thing I HATE/despise is the ball having the trace where it will bounce/go. It feels "too easy" to know where the ball is going to go instead of having to figure it out like in the old days (Maybe put it as an option that could be disabled?).

With all that said, right now the game is awesome with some personal/subjective things that I feel are not faithful to the original game.

P.S: If Luna replaces Zoe in the plot, will we get bamboozled with a Luna clone like in the original game? How will the Sendell-conquer the world play here with FunFrock

After completing the game 100% here's my review:

Pros:

- Chill to play
- Not so difficult
- Relaxing
- Upgrade tree

Cons:

- Buggy as hell. There's been some levels where the bubbles randomly exploded and the level was finished instantly (yes, it works in your favour but come on; it takes away any difficulty it may have...).
- Same levels but larger every time. The addition of new colors only give some iteration to the levels but that's it. Same mechanics and difficulty.
- Yellow and Orange bubbles can be easily mistaken. Happened to me and I'm not colorblind.
- The music. OH GOD THE MUSIC. I had to play this game muted because its music is ANNOYING. 1 track all game long through 250 levels. It would make anyone insane...
- Powers are OK but there are not enough levels to get points for EVERY upgrade. So you need to choose "wisely".



Would I recommend it for a 100% completition? If you like your sanity, don't do it.

But for 0,90€ you can buy it and chill a bit with it. That way it's somehow worth it.
